    first things first, give them a wash. pull the whole unit out from the car but dont open the tensioner unit. wash the belt with warm soapy water. suddenly it will retract again! can also add some low friction pieces of tape to the selt belt anchor loops. cant remember the name of this stuff, so a search this has been suggested before...
